Default Front Plate Bluues :(

So I Bought my car on the 5th. It is a USED 09 G8 GT. And it was originally from Michigan (Where, I am assuming, front plates are not required). So since it is used, the new car inspection sticker (which is good for 4 years) is no longer on the car. I have to get the car inspected. And wonderful New Jersey requires a front license plate. However, I have no mount, and there are no holes yet. I wanted to keep it that way! I dont want to drill into my front end! But, to get it inspected, I have to have one. What should I do?????
